Weboutpatient follow suggested frequency of FBC monitoring and a clearly Guidelines for GP referral and further investigation of patients with elevated haematocrit Web14 de mar. de 2024 · Haemolytic anaemia is characterised by the premature destruction of red blood cells. Anaemia, reticulocytosis, low haptoglobin, high lactate dehydrogenase, and high indirect bilirubin suggest haemolysis. Direct antiglobulin test (Coombs') is important for differentiating immune from non-immune aetiologies. Peripheral smear review is …

Haemoglobin (Hb) Anaemia phoebe song lather rinse repeatWeb13 de mar. de 2024 · Summary. Anaemia of chronic disease (ACD) is characterised by anaemia and evidence of immune system activation. Anaemia is mainly due to decreased red blood cell production; may be aggravated by shortened red blood cell survival.
